# only-gnu | |
# only-linux | |
-include ../tools.mk | |
# This ensures that std::env::args works in a library called from C on glibc Linux. | |
all: | |
$(RUSTC) --crate-type=staticlib library.rs | |
$(CC) program.c $(call STATICLIB,library) $(call OUT_EXE,program) \ | |
$(EXTRACFLAGS) $(EXTRACXXFLAGS) | |
$(call RUN,program) |